Claiming Career Fulfillment by Embracing Mental Health and Self-Worth

This week, host Bernie Borges speaks with Chief People Officer Shamayne Braman, a fellow speaker at the upcoming HR Wellness and Executive Summit. They explore what it really means to experience career fulfillment, moving beyond titles, compensation, and prestige.
Here are three powerful takeaways from their conversation:
1️⃣ Redefining Failure and Building Resilience
Early in her career, Shamayne joined Teach for America expecting to connect effortlessly with her students. Instead, she faced unexpected rejection, an experience that tested her assumptions and pushed her to build trust through humility, grit, and self-awareness. These early lessons became a foundation for her leadership journey across industries.
2️⃣ Leading with Genuine Care and Human Connection
Across roles in education, healthcare, retail, and tech, Shamayne’s leadership has been grounded in deep care for people. Whether supporting students or leading HR teams, she focuses on unlocking individual potential and closing the gap between where people are and where they can go.
3️⃣ Wellness as a Professional Advantage
Shamayne shares how her personal health and fitness practices, including mental well-being, fuel her performance as a leader. By prioritizing self-care, embracing stillness, and rejecting the stigma around mental health, she ensures she leads from a place of strength, clarity, and empathy.
One Main Takeaway:
Career fulfillment isn’t defined by what’s on your résumé. Through resilience, authentic relationships, and intentional self-care, we build a living legacy that’s felt in every interaction, not just remembered after we’re gone.
